共用方式為


DsListServersInSiteA 函式 (ntdsapi.h)

DsListServersInSite 函式會列出站臺中的所有伺服器。

語法

NTDSAPI DWORD DsListServersInSiteA(
  [in]  HANDLE           hDs,
  [in]  LPCSTR           site,
  [out] PDS_NAME_RESULTA *ppServers
);

參數

[in] hDs

包含從 DSBindDSBindWithCred 函式取得的目錄服務句柄。

[in] site

指定月台名稱之 Null 終止字串的指標。 網站名稱會使用辨別名稱格式。 其取自 DsListSites 函式所傳回的網站清單。

[out] ppServers

指向接收站台中伺服器清單之 DS_NAME_RESULT 結構的指標。 傳回的結構必須使用 DsFreeNameResult 函式來釋放。

傳回值

如果函式傳回伺服器清單,則傳回值會 NO_ERROR。 如果函式失敗,傳回值可以是下列其中一個錯誤碼。

言論

傳回的 DS_NAME_RESULT 結構中會報告個別名稱轉換錯誤。

注意

ntdsapi.h 標頭會將 DsListServersInSite 定義為別名,根據 UNICODE 預處理器常數的定義,自動選取此函式的 ANSI 或 Unicode 版本。 混合使用編碼中性別名與非編碼中性的程序代碼,可能會導致編譯或運行時間錯誤不符。 如需詳細資訊,請參閱函式原型的 慣例。

要求

要求 價值
最低支援的用戶端 Windows Vista
支援的最低伺服器 Windows Server 2008
目標平臺 窗戶
標頭 ntdsapi.h
連結庫 Ntdsapi.lib
DLL Ntdsapi.dll

另請參閱

DS_NAME_RESULT

域控制器和復寫管理功能

DsFreeNameResult